Gold and power in ancient costa rica, panama, and colombia. The muisca, quimbaya, calima, tairona, tolima and zenu chiefdoms in ancient colombia used gold to fashion some of the most visually dramatic and sophisticated works of art found anywhere in the americas before european contact. These civilizations were organized in tribes, each ruled by a chief or cacique. The significance of gold to these ancient colombian populations cannot be understood in terms of the modern currency driven desire to possess this rare metal.
